Comic Description
Part of the 'Creatures on the Loose' storyline. Spider-Man battles Doctor Octopus, who is searching for Aunt May. Spider-Man is struggling with his recent loss of powers (due to previous issues) while dealing with a winter setting and the return of Mary Jane's sister.

Grading Recommendation
Not recommended for grading unless sentimental value is high. The cost of professional grading will likely exceed the market value of the book for this specific issue.
Notable Features
Features Doctor Octopus. Part of the 50 Years of Captain America anniversary celebration (noted by the bottom left corner logo). Direct Edition (indicated by the Captain America graphic instead of a barcode).
